Who owns Lamborghini?
Following lengthy negotiations, Automobili Lamborghini S. A. July 10, 1998. Lamborghini became the Volkswagen Group’s third luxury brand alongside Bentley and Bugatti in 1998. What is the cheapest Lamborghini?
There are eight trims available for what is considered Lamborghini’s entry-level model, with prices topping out at $331,000 for the STO coupe. The absolute cheapest of the group is a new base Huracán EVO RWD Coupe with an MSRP of $209,409 . In contrast to the Aventador, the Lamborghini Huracán offers a more accessible entry point into the world of Lamborghini supercars. The base price of the Huracán generally starts around $250,000, making it a more affordable option compared to its bigger sibling.The Lamborghini Huracán (Spanish for hurricane; [uɾaˈkan]) is a sports car built by Italian automotive manufacturer Lamborghini from 2014 to 2024.As a super-sports car, the Lamborghini Huracán delivers all the power and technology of a genuine race car in a road-legal model.
